Ryan Walters could step down as State Superintendent, report says

Oklahoma State Superintendent Ryan Walters is considering resigning from his role, according to sources with NOTUS, a digital news outlet based in Washington, D.C. Walters’ resignation could come as soon as this week, according to NOTUS.
Sources told NOTUS that Walters is believed to have another job lined up.
Griffin Media has reached out to Ryan Walters, but has not heard back.
